William Tell

William Tell (1958-1959)

EndedScripted showAction, Adventure, Family

Set in the fourteenth century during the hostile Austrian occupation of Switzerland, William Tell is a reluctant freedom fighter, battling heroically against the tyranny and oppression of the invading forces
